Output 16dde626664cbfd12131ced10da3b398eb077ae51d8d4deafb0eebcc2f8da2c2:0

value
5386599
script pubkey
OP_0 OP_PUSHBYTES_20 4245b630fcc71543c72d479802059c1dbae546d4
address
bc1qgfzmvv8ucu2583edg7vqypvurkaw23k5nmhlx0
transaction
16dde626664cbfd12131ced10da3b398eb077ae51d8d4deafb0eebcc2f8da2c2
confirmations
48465
spent
true